Overview

University of Wisconsin Eau Claire is a Public Large campus based in Eau Claire, WI. Families comparing U.S. options often start here for transparent cost and outcome numbers. Reported acceptance rate is approximately 76.1%, which suggests relatively open access compared with highly selective peers. Federal outcome data shows a graduation rate near 67.6%. Enrollment is about 8,995 students, giving the campus a mid-size feel.

Tuition, aid, and value

For University of Wisconsin Eau Claire, published sticker prices include in-state tuition around $9,277 and out-of-state / international tuition around $18,516 per year (before fees, housing, and books). After typical grant aid, the average net price reported to the Department of Education is about $16,948. International students usually pay out-of-state rates unless a specific waiver applies.

Among graduates tracked in federal earnings data, median alumni salary is about $58,561 ten years after entry — useful context, not a guarantee of individual outcomes.
